Transaction 25649940a267984e70d829c6cc25120c7b5d70682e060c975e9976d59df2413b

1 Input
2 Outputs
  • 25649940a267984e70d829c6cc25120c7b5d70682e060c975e9976d59df2413b:0
  • value  7743
    address  13Xh1KSN5qqFsom3iVKDGVjrqrbG3BaHbm
  • 25649940a267984e70d829c6cc25120c7b5d70682e060c975e9976d59df2413b:1
  • value  1692741
    address  3PYDbmkSfsKhMPcTuL2YZKwBcGiXpAk8bP